General information about eps

In Austria Computop Paygate supports online money transfer with the Austrian Electronic Payment Standard (EPS). EPS is an established system for e-commerce payments in Austria offering a payment guarantee to the merchant. The customer can use the familiar and trusted online banking of its own credit institution, just the same as with online banking.

With online banking, the data disclosed in the online transfer is encrypted with SSL (Secure Sockets Layer) to prevent manipulation.

Calling the eps interface

The eps connection with a Paygate form can be either direct or via PPRO, where the interface form and process are largely identical. With the PPRO connection there are a few added parameters which are explained separately in the table. Subsequent credits and batch transfer credits can only be made with the PPRO connection.

To make a payment in Austria with eps online transfer via a Paygate form, please use the following URL:

 

Notice: For security reasons, Computop Paygate rejects all payment requests with formatting errors. Therefore, please use the correct data type for each parameter.

ReqId

ans..32

O

To avoid double payments or actions (e.g. by ETM), enter an alphanumeric value which identifies your transaction and may be assigned only once. If the transaction or action is submitted again with the same ReqID, Computop Paygate will not carry out the payment or new action, but will just return the status of the original transaction or action.

Please note that the Computop Paygate must have a finalized transaction status for the first initial action (authentication/authorisation). This does not apply to 3-D Secure authentications that are terminated by a timeout. The 3-D Secure Timeout status does not count as a completed status in which the ReqID functionality on Paygate does not take effect. Submissions with identical ReqID for an open status will be processed regularly.

Notice: Please note that a ReqID is only valid for 12 month, then it gets deleted at the Paygate.

Credit with reference

Credits (refunds) are possible via a Server-to-Server connection. Eps credits are only allowed with the PPRO connection. Paygate permits only credits for eps that reference on a capture previously made via Paygate. The amount of the Credit is limited to the amount of the previous capture.

Batch processing via the interface

Basic information about using Batch files and about their structure can be found in the Batch Manager manual. Within batch processing not alle functions are available which are usually available for the online interface.

This section describes the parameters which must be transferred with the data set (Record) for executing an eps credit and which information can be found within the response file about the payment status.

Notice: Please note that Batch processing for eps is possible only via PPRO connection.

The structure for an eps credit within a Batch file to be submitted is the following:

HEAD,<MerchantID>,<Date>,<Version>
EPS,Credit,<PayID>,<TransID>,(<RefNr>),<Amount>,<Currency>
FOOT,<CountRecords>,<SumAmount>
